Swartberg Country Manor is nestled on the Voorbedachfarm which is situated in the Cango Valley at the foot of the world-renowned Swartberg Pass. The picturesque panoramic view of the Swartberg Mountains will bring comfort to anyone that wants to get away from it all and simply soak up the peace of its tranquil surroundings.

To add to this timeless era, we have not only converted the main farmhouse into a comfortable guest house that offers nine en-suite guest rooms, we have also renovated the original farmhouse, dated 1864, to offer a further five en-suite guest rooms. It is impossible not to fall in love with this historical work of art with its ambience and character added by Oregon pine floors and ceilings with perfectly framed mountain views.

Our dedicated team will be your hosts and will ensure that you have an unforgettable homely experience. We aim to take you back in time when life was less complicated and friends still had ample time to enjoy long and hearty discussions. Adding good traditional food and comfortable accommodation to this farm experience, we trust that you will rediscover your soul.

Meals are served in our spacious dining room or on the veranda overlooking the spectacular Swartberg Mountains. For those exquisite warm summer days, traditional South African delicacies will be prepared outside on open fires next to the swimming pool, along with refreshing beverages served from the bar.

Voorbedacht is a working farm which offers guests the unique opportunity to explore and experience the true essence of subsistence farming in the Little Karoo. Among the various agricultural products farmed, we also farm livestock such as cattle, sheep and ostriches. Daily walks on the farm allow guests to experience the peace and serenity of this beautiful valley, while for the more wild at heart, mountain bikes are available to explore the more rugged terrain.

Swartberg Country Manor is the perfect central destination from which many other places of interest can be accessed. Among these are the world-renowned Cango Caves which is a must for any first time visitor to our region, as well as the Congo Ostrich and Crocodile Farm. The Garden Route is accessible with George being only one hour’s drive away. Since the farm is situated at the foot of the Swartberg Mountain, it’s a mere 12 km drive to the top of the pass which offers breathtaking views of the Cango Valley. The descent from here takes you past the entrance to the renowned Gamkaskloof; also referred to by the locals as Die Hel which snakes down until you reach picturesque Prince Albert.

A circular route over the pass through Prince Albert and Meiringspoort is an estimated 3 hours’ drive and is arguably one of the most scenic routes our beautiful country has to offer. Oudtshoorn offers interesting historical buildings of which one is Arbeidsgenot - the original residence of the celebrated writer C.J. Langenhoven. Impressive sandstone buildings are witness to the flourishing ostrich farming industry of a bygone era that esteemed Oudtshoorn as the then Ostrich Capital of the world.
